Paleontologists typically make between $2,500 to $5,000 per month, although salaries can vary based on factors such as experience, education, and the specific employer. Entry-level paleontologists may earn on the lower end of this range, while those with advanced degrees and more experience may earn closer to the higher end.

Paleontologists can make varying salaries depending on their level of experience, education, and where they are employed. On average, a paleontologist in the United States can make anywhere from $40,000 to $100,000 per year. Academic positions may pay less than industry or museum positions.
